Wanapan

Wanapan or Arapahtë pata is a Tiriyó village in the Sipaliwini District of Suriname.

[3] Since the arrival of missionaries to the Surinamese interior in the 1950s, the Tiriyó have increasingly moved to larger population centres close to airfields, such as Alalapadu and Kwamalasamutu.

While this facilitated the work of the missionaries and the Surinamese government, it also meant that soils and hunting areas were over-extracted.

After Asongo Alalaparu was installed as granman of the Tiriyó in 1997, he motivated his people to disperse again.

The nearest school and clinic are located in Apoera, which lies about one day travelling downstream by motorized canoe.
